Luxembourg to recognize Palestinian state at UN General Assembly
Prime Minister Luc Frieden and Foreign Minister Xavier Bettel announce intention before parliamentary commission, according to media reports

WASHINGTON
Luxembourg intends to recognize Palestine as a state later this month at the UN General Assembly in New York, local media reported Monday.
Prime Minister Luc Frieden and Foreign Minister Xavier Bettel made the announcement before a parliamentary commission, according to the reports.
Last Friday, the UN General Assembly adopted a resolution endorsing the “New York Declaration,” which seeks to recognize a Palestinian state and advance a two-state solution to the Israeli-Palestinian conflict.
